P#39 ran for over two decades with only minor modifications — an unusually long lifespan for a circulating note of this denomination, and a direct reflection of the low pace of reform at the Pakistan Security Printing Corporation during the 1980s and 1990s. The 10-rupee note occupied a heavily used position in everyday transactions, and surviving examples in anything above well-worn condition are not especially common for the earlier dated issues.
The single watermark security feature places this squarely in a pre-modern security regime — PSPC did not introduce more sophisticated elements to lower denominations until well into the 2000s.
